One Of The Best Rapid Application Development Instruments In 2024
As the launch deadline approaches, the staff focuses on completing essential performance https://www.globalcloudteam.com/ whereas remaining versatile to accommodate any last-minute changes or updates. In The End, the startup efficiently launches the project management software just in time for the trade event, garnering constructive suggestions from customers and stakeholders alike. Speedy Utility Improvement (RAD) is a software improvement methodology that emphasizes speed and flexibility. It focuses on creating prototypes and refining them by way of iterative user feedback quite than relying on a inflexible, predefined growth plan.
Speedy application improvement (RAD) is a strategy focused on fast prototyping and iterative growth of software program purposes. Fast Utility Improvement (RAD) is a software program development methodology centered on fast and iterative supply of high-quality functions. Unlike conventional approaches that involve lengthy planning and design phases, RAD emphasizes quick prototyping, fixed user suggestions, and versatile changes throughout the event process.
Rad Vs Agile Vs Waterfall Methodologies
For enterprise-level purchasers that already possess extensively developed belongings, RAD can facilitate rapidly integrating these belongings into new functions. This state of affairs is typical when an enterprise needs AI as a Service a quick resolution for inside use or to test a brand new concept. In this case, RAD is agile enough to create a useful product with minimum growth efforts. Fast application growth has 4 phases or elements that represent the overarching framework—requirement gathering, rapid prototyping, development, and deployment. Compared to other development models, fast utility development is comparatively cheap, but there are some situations the place the developments could be costly due to RAD traits. The bright side is, if you’ve obtained the staff, you may get the thought from idea to finish product lots faster than other fashions.
There are, nonetheless, various frameworks that help development throughout completely different programming languages and can output information for particular platforms. These instruments typically trade off full native performance for broader compatibility. Documentation and different coaching materials are prepared to make sure that customers can find the performance they use and see the complete advantage of the software program. The refinement that RAD allowed for within the earlier phases helps you create software that’s simple for users to know and for developers to document. In addition to steady integration and testing, suggestions provides a significant mechanism for identifying and fixing issues early in the process when their impression is still minimal. The focus on rapid supply and minimization of wasted effort makes RAD a cost-effective possibility.
What Is Rad? Definition, Which Means And Benefits
The broad nature of the necessities helps you’re taking the time to segment particular requirements at totally different points of the event cycle. Whether you are a startup racing to launch your MVP or an enterprise modernizing legacy methods, the ability to construct and launch applications shortly can make or break your success. Businesses throughout each business are underneath mounting pressure to innovate rapidly, meet rising user expectations, and bring new options to market quicker than ever earlier than.
RAD is efficient for rapidly prototyping new ideas or validating ideas before committing to full-scale growth. It permits rapid application development cloud organizations to check feasibility and gather feedback early in the course of. Armed with useful person insights, it’s time to refine your prototype and begin creating core functionalities. It’s important to do not overlook that Speedy Utility Growth is best suited for initiatives with well-defined core functionalities and a clear understanding of person needs. Nected can complement FileMaker by including rule-based automation and backend workflows for complicated information handling. Nected adds powerful rule-based automation and backend processing capabilities to enrich Nintex’s workflow solutions.
Factors To Be Think About Before Implementing Rad Model
They may discover that one of many necessities that sounded good on paper back in part one doesn’t add something to the working prototype. After internalizing feedback from the consumer and other stakeholders, groups can get back to work on the prototype. Groups taking the RAD approach move initiatives via four phases to measure progress in real-time. Implementation section involves deploying the application to production or making it available to end-users. This includes configuring servers, organising safety measures, and guaranteeing the application is accessible to customers. This part takes a deep dive into the five steps of the RAD process, utilizing the example of creating healthcare app to assist sufferers handle their diabetes.
- However, it’s unsuitable for large tasks, can be resource-intensive, and is subject to scope creep.
- The goal is to ensure the system meets users’ needs as successfully as possible.
- Throughout the event process, the shopper was able to present input as to what functionalities had been required.
Fashionable frameworks like React, Angular, and Vue.js dominate frontend improvement due to their component-based architectures. For styling, CSS frameworks like Tailwind provide utility-first lessons, enabling rapid prototyping with out customized code. The development phase entails the actual improvement of the applying using speedy prototyping techniques. Builders work closely with customers and stakeholders to shortly construct and refine the system’s features. Having expert developers is crucial for creating iterative prototypes, and ongoing user involvement is essential for providing priceless feedback. If these assets are lacking, the effectiveness of the RAD method can suffer.For instance, a small enterprise with restricted IT abilities might find it difficult to meet the collaborative demands of RAD.
Radzen Blazor Studio is a software program improvement surroundings that empowers developers to design, construct and deploy Blazor functions without the normal hurdles. RAD is ideal for initiatives requiring flexibility and sooner delivery and the place requirements are expected to evolve primarily based on person feedback. If, based mostly on this article, you contemplate the RAD mannequin the best choice for your software, you could find it useful to rent a staff of skilled builders to assist you with speedy app growth. At Binariks, we now have expertise with RAD project improvement inside different deadlines and budgets.
When it comes to precise development, your alternative of platform might rely upon the target surroundings. After establishing the project requirements, you’ll have complete pointers that will help pinpoint the necessities on your improvement instruments. This is the ultimate part of improvement, when the software strikes from growth to production. During this section, any final testing and bug fixes are carried out to ensure the software is prepared for real-world use. This is where the finalized design is fleshed out right into a useful piece of software program. Generate code primarily based on visual designs or use code templates to automate commonplace functionality.
With platforms like FAB Builder, many of those phases are streamlined through automation and visible instruments. If you’re building a new app that should combine with legacy systems or third-party APIs, RAD can introduce technical challenges. The need for quick prototyping might overlook long-term integration or scalability concerns, which might trigger problems later in manufacturing. You’ll want experienced developers, designers, and testers who can multitask, work in parallel, and make speedy choices. If your staff lacks the required expertise or availability, RAD can decelerate instead of dashing up. Builders and customers can check new ideas rapidly, discover totally different solutions, and pivot without the concern of long delays or wasted effort.
So, if you need to develop an app utilizing RAD, as a quantity one app development company, we might help you maximize your time and ideas. We have an experienced team of builders having experience in creating and delivering apps utilizing rapid utility development. Fast Utility Growth (RAD) is an agile methodology that emphasizes speedy prototype launches and prototypes. Unlike the Waterfall approach, RAD prioritizes applications and person input over inflexible preparation and necessities info.
Fast Utility Growth (RAD) is a transformative strategy to software program creation, offering exceptional speed, flexibility, and collaboration. By specializing in rapid prototyping and iterative suggestions, RAD is changing how companies and developers deal with application design. This information presents a comprehensive overview of RAD, together with its methodology, advantages, challenges, and contemporary functions, as nicely as methods for businesses to put it to use successfully. Quick Base is a well-established low-code growth platform offering a range of features for building customized enterprise purposes. It caters to businesses of all sizes looking for to streamline workflows and enhance knowledge administration. However, the steeper studying curve, doubtlessly complicated pricing, and limited design flexibility might be drawbacks compared to Knack, notably for groups new to RAD improvement.